15 minute rule
Hayley insists everyone should wear SPF daily to protect themselves from UV rays, whatever the weather.
And your secret hack? Wait at least 15 minutes for the product to absorb into the skin before applying makeup.
She said: “Applying makeup immediately after SPF can interfere with the absorption process, which means you may not be as protected and can also lead to uneven coverage or makeup application.”
Prime time
Hayley also revealed that primer is an essential step in her makeup routine during a heatwave.
She said: “A step in the makeup routine that often goes unnoticed on those busy work days, however, this step is crucial to ensuring your makeup withstands the heat and lasts all day.
“The Primer creates a smooth surface for makeup to adhere to, as well as offering that extra dose of hydration, essential to ensure your look stays put.”
Less is more
“Opt for minimalist makeup in the heat,” added the makeup expert.
“Wearing more layers of makeup increases the chances of uneven makeup at the end of the day.
“Take off the makeup look and opt for a light, dewy foundation, thick brows, and glossy lips for a cool, calm, and collected summer makeup look that lasts all day.”
Waterproofing
Hayley revealed: “It can be tough outside in the heat, so switching to waterproof products can help stop your makeup from sweating throughout the day.

Matte
“While a dewy foundation is a must-have makeup look, in warmer weather your skin naturally looks more luminous as you sweat more,” adds Hayley.

Gunpowder power
Hayley says: “Certain parts of the face are more likely to shine when dealing with heat, so apply translucent powder to areas like the T-zone to keep your complexion looking fresh.
“Remember, don’t use too much powder as it can look cakey in the heat and make sure to replenish these areas throughout the day.”
Lock it up
Hayley encourages beauty fans to “fix your look” with a good setting spray.
She said: “The spray setting prevents makeup from smudging and melting in hot weather.
“Then, once you’re happy with your look, apply a few sprays to make your makeup smudge-proof.
“You can also use a setting spray to refresh your makeup throughout the day.”
Smudge until you fall
“If you find oily areas throughout the day, make sure you have pads on hand to help remove excess oil and keep your makeup from sliding off,” insisted Hayley.
Stay protected from the sun
And finally, SPF is a must.
Hayley said: “In warmer weather you should reapply your SPF throughout the day, but using a cream will end up messing with your makeup look.
“Many brands now offer sprays or roll-ons with SPF for your face to help you top up your sunscreen on the go without messing up your makeup.”
